Outline of Final Research Achievements

Recent CMOS image sensors have several image acquisition modes such as (1) high-resolution and normal-frame-rate and (2) low-resolution and high-frame-rate. Assuming these two types of video, that is high-resolution video and high-frame-rate video, can be obtained simultaneously, a motion-compensated frame interpolation method to generate high-resolution and high-frame-rate video from these videos is proposed. By using the proposed approach, efficient video acquisition can be archived. Considering adaptive processing based on motions in video sequences, a image shrinking based high-speed moving region extraction method is also proposed.
